Curator: Curators manage collections of artwork or historic items and may conduct public service activities for an institution. They may research, authenticate, or appraise items and organize collections or exhibits. Museum Educator: Museum educators are responsible for the development and implementation of educational programs and activities in museums, historical sites, zoos, and other cultural institutions. They design and lead tours, workshops, and other events to engage the public and promote learning. Archaeologist: Archaeologists study past human cultures by excavating sites, analyzing artifacts, and reconstructing past environments. They use various methods, such as remote sensing and geophysical surveys, to locate and document archaeological sites and materials. Conservator: Conservators work to preserve and protect objects of cultural, historical, or artistic significance. They use scientific principles, materials analysis, and practical techniques to clean, repair, and stabilize objects in museums, libraries, and other institutions. Historian: Historians research, analyze, interpret, and present the past by studying historical documents and sources. They may specialize in particular periods or aspects of history and often work in museums, archives, and universities.
